Testosterone is a hormone that plays an important role in the body. It helps to regulate sex drive, bone density, and muscle mass. Testosterone levels can decline with age, and low levels can cause a variety of symptoms, including fatigue, low libido, and decreased muscle mass. Testosterone replacement therapy is a treatment option for men with low testosterone levels.
There are two main types of testosterone therapy: at-home therapy and clinical therapy.
Both types of therapy are effective, but they have different advantages and disadvantages.
The best type of therapy for each individual depends on his preferences and lifestyle.
Though testosterone therapy is most often performed in a clinical setting, some men opt for at-home testosterone therapy. There are pros and cons to both approaches. Clinical testosterone therapy is performed by a trained medical professional and can be customized to each individual patient. At-home testosterone therapy, on the other hand, gives patients more control over their treatment. Ultimately, the best approach depends on the individual patient and his unique needs.
